The 38-year-old man who suffered burns in the explosion at his home on Sunday morning remains hospitalized in critical condition at Sassari Hospital. Aleandro Frau is being closely monitored by doctors, but initial findings indicate his life is not in danger.
Meanwhile, firefighters are continuing their investigations to determine the cause of the incident: an explosion that only by chance prevented a tragedy. Initial reconstructions suggest that the air in a room of the second-floor house on Via Boccaccio was saturated with gas, which had leaked simultaneously from two cylinders.
It seems unlikely that both gas cylinders were defective, but further investigations will clarify exactly what actually happened in that house. There was certainly a gas leak, followed by a spark and that explosion, with a roar heard all the way to the center of town. It was a moment of great turmoil, with neighbors immediately rushing out into the street, and even Aleandro Frau managed to escape the inferno of fire and smoke. The 38-year-old, however, suffered burns to several parts of his body and was transferred to the hospital in Sassari, where he remains hospitalized.
The damage to his home was extensive, and nearby buildings were also damaged.
